Create sweet meals with this honey-themed cookbook, featuring 50 recipes complemented by full-color photographs of each dish.

Around the globe and dating back to ancient times, honey has been considered “liquid gold” for its uses as a sweetener and as medicine. It is an obvious choice as a food ingredient, and honey’s naturally antibacterial, anti-inflammatory properties make it ideal for incorporating in spa treatments. Honey is a cookbook by Julia Rutland that features 50 recipes—from drinks to desserts to entrees—for cooks who enjoy great flavor. The author is a professional writer, recipe developer, recipe tester, food stylist, and television/media demonstrator, so you can be certain that every dish is a crowd-pleaser! The book’s full-color photography adds to the enjoyment of cooking. Plus, tips about honey varieties and how to help pollinators, as well as honeycrafting ideas, add to the value of this wonderful cookbook. Julia further provides plenty of useful information on buying honey, using it as a replacement for granulated sugar, and more.

We love honey because it sweetens and enhances flavors naturally and it provides a natural energy boost. Add Honey to your cookbook collection, and put a little extra sweetness into your life.
